forked from GitHub/gf-core
add bulgarian language (still incomplete)
This commit is contained in:
157
lib/resource/bulgarian/LexiconBul.gf
Normal file
157
lib/resource/bulgarian/LexiconBul.gf
Normal file
@@ -0,0 +1,157 @@
|
||||
--# -path=.:prelude
|
||||
|
||||
concrete LexiconBul of Lexicon = CatBul **
|
||||
open ParadigmsBul, Prelude in {
|
||||
|
||||
flags
|
||||
optimize=values ;
|
||||
|
||||
lin
|
||||
bad_A = mkA76 "ëîř" ;
|
||||
beautiful_A = mkA76 "ęđŕńčâ" ;
|
||||
big_A = mkA81 "ăîë˙ě" ;
|
||||
black_A = mkA79 "÷ĺđĺí" ;
|
||||
blue_A = mkA86 "ńčí" ;
|
||||
break_V2 = dirV2 (mkV173 "÷óď˙") ;
|
||||
brown_A = mkA76 "ęŕô˙â" ;
|
||||
buy_V2 = dirV2 (mkV173 "ęóď˙") ;
|
||||
clean_A = mkA76 "÷čńň" ;
|
||||
clever_A = mkA79 "óěĺí" ;
|
||||
close_V2 = dirV2 (mkV173 "çŕňâîđ˙") ;
|
||||
cold_A = mkA76 "ńňóäĺí" ;
|
||||
come_V = mkV146a "äîéäŕ" ;
|
||||
die_V = mkV150a "óěđŕ" ;
|
||||
dirty_A = mkA79 "ěđúńĺí" ;
|
||||
drink_V2 = dirV2 (mkV163 "ďč˙") ;
|
||||
eat_V2 = dirV2 (mkV169 "˙ě") ;
|
||||
empty_A = mkA79 "ďđŕçĺí" ;
|
||||
find_V2 = dirV2 (mkV173 "íŕěĺđ˙") ;
|
||||
forget_V2 = dirV2 (mkV173 "çŕáđŕâ˙") ;
|
||||
good_A = mkA80 "äîáúđ" ;
|
||||
go_V = mkV186 "îňčâŕě" ;
|
||||
green_A = mkA76 "çĺëĺí" ;
|
||||
hate_V2 = dirV2 (mkV173 "ěđŕç˙") ;
|
||||
have_V2 = dirV2 (mkV186 "čěŕě") ;
|
||||
hear_V2 = dirV2 (mkV186 "÷óâŕě") ;
|
||||
hot_A = mkA76 "ăîđĺů" ;
|
||||
important_A = mkA79 "âŕćĺí" ;
|
||||
know_V2 = dirV2 (mkV162 "çíŕ˙") ;
|
||||
learn_V2 = dirV2 (mkV176 "ó÷ŕ") ;
|
||||
leave_V2 = dirV2 (mkV173 "îńňŕâ˙") ;
|
||||
like_V2 = dirV2 (mkV186 "őŕđĺńâŕě") ;
|
||||
listen_V2 = dirV2 (mkV186 "ńëóřŕě") ;
|
||||
live_V = mkV160 "ćčâĺ˙" ;
|
||||
long_A = mkA80 "äúëúă" ;
|
||||
lose_V2 = dirV2 (mkV173 "ăóá˙") ;
|
||||
love_V2 = dirV2 (mkV186 "îáč÷ŕě") ;
|
||||
-- married_A2 = mkA2 (mkA76 "ćĺíĺí") toP ;
|
||||
narrow_A = mkA84 "ňĺńĺí" ;
|
||||
new_A = mkA76 "íîâ" ;
|
||||
old_A = mkA76 "ńňŕđ" ;
|
||||
open_V2 = dirV2 (mkV187 "îňâŕđ˙ě") ;
|
||||
play_V2 = dirV2 (mkV161 "čăđŕ˙") ;
|
||||
read_V2 = dirV2 (mkV145 "÷ĺňŕ") ;
|
||||
red_A = mkA76 "÷ĺđâĺí" ;
|
||||
run_V = (mkV186 "á˙ăŕě") ;
|
||||
seek_V2 = dirV2 (mkV173 "ňúđń˙") ;
|
||||
see_V2 = dirV2 (mkV186 "âčćäŕě") ;
|
||||
sell_V3 = dirV3 (mkV186 "ďđîäŕâŕě") naP ;
|
||||
send_V3 = dirV3 (mkV186 "ďđŕůŕě") doP ;
|
||||
short_A = mkA76 "ęúń" ;
|
||||
sleep_V = mkV182 "ńď˙" ;
|
||||
small_A = mkA80 "ěŕëúę" ;
|
||||
speak_V2 = dirV2 (mkV173 "ăîâîđ˙") ;
|
||||
stupid_A = mkA76 "ăëóďŕâ" ;
|
||||
switch8off_V2 = dirV2 (mkV186 "čçęëţ÷âŕě") ;
|
||||
switch8on_V2 = dirV2 (mkV186 "âęëţ÷âŕě") ;
|
||||
teach_V2 = dirV2 (mkV186 "ďđĺďîäŕâŕě") ;
|
||||
thick_A = mkA76 "äĺáĺë" ;
|
||||
thin_A = mkA80 "ňúíúę" ;
|
||||
travel_V = mkV186 "ďúňóâŕě" ;
|
||||
ugly_A = mkA76 "ăëóďŕâ" ;
|
||||
understand_V2 = dirV2 (mkV186 "đŕçáčđŕě") ;
|
||||
wait_V2 = prepV2 (mkV186 "÷ŕęŕě") zaP ;
|
||||
walk_V = mkV173 "őîä˙" ;
|
||||
warm_A = mkA80 "ňîďúë" ;
|
||||
watch_V2 = dirV2 (mkV186 "ăëĺäŕě") ;
|
||||
white_A = mkA81 "á˙ë" ;
|
||||
win_V2 = dirV2 (mkV174 "ďîáĺä˙") ;
|
||||
|
||||
write_V2 = dirV2 (mkV159 "ďčřŕ") ;
|
||||
yellow_A = mkA76 "ćúëň" ;
|
||||
young_A = mkA76 "ěëŕä" ;
|
||||
-- do_V2 = dirV2 (mk5V "do" "does" "did" "done" "doing") ;
|
||||
now_Adv = mkAdv "ńĺăŕ" ;
|
||||
already_Adv = mkAdv "âĺ÷ĺ" ;
|
||||
-- put_V2 = prepV2 (irregDuplV "put" "put" "put") noPrep ;
|
||||
stop_V = mkV150 "ńďđŕ" ;
|
||||
jump_V = mkV176 "ńęî÷ŕ" ;
|
||||
far_Adv = mkAdv "äŕëĺ÷ĺ" ;
|
||||
correct_A = mkA79 "ďđŕâčëĺí" ;
|
||||
dry_A = mkA76 "ńóő" ;
|
||||
-- dull_A = regA "dull" ;
|
||||
full_A = mkA79 "ďúëĺí" ;
|
||||
heavy_A = mkA80 "ňĺćúę" ;
|
||||
near_A = mkA80 "áëčçúę" ;
|
||||
-- rotten_A = (regA "rotten") ;
|
||||
round_A = mkA80 "ęđúăúë" ;
|
||||
sharp_A = mkA80 "îńňúđ" ;
|
||||
-- smooth_A = regA "smooth" ;
|
||||
-- straight_A = regA "straight" ;
|
||||
wet_A = mkA80 "ěîęúđ" ; ----
|
||||
wide_A = mkA76 "řčđîę" ;
|
||||
-- blow_V = IrregEng.blow_V ;
|
||||
-- breathe_V = dirV2 (regV "breathe") ;
|
||||
burn_V = mkV187 "čçăŕđ˙ě" ;
|
||||
-- dig_V = IrregEng.dig_V ;
|
||||
-- fall_V = IrregEng.fall_V ;
|
||||
float_V = mkV186 "ďëŕâŕě" ;
|
||||
flow_V = mkV148 "ňĺęŕ" ;
|
||||
fly_V = mkV177 "ëĺň˙" ;
|
||||
freeze_V = mkV186 "çŕěđúçâŕě" ;
|
||||
laugh_V = mkV160 "ńěĺ˙" ;
|
||||
lie_V = mkV178 "ëĺćŕ" ;
|
||||
play_V = mkV161 "čăđŕ˙" ;
|
||||
-- sew_V = IrregEng.sew_V ;
|
||||
sing_V = mkV164 "ďĺ˙" ;
|
||||
-- sit_V = IrregEng.sit_V ;
|
||||
smell_V = mkV159 "ěčđčřŕ" ;
|
||||
spit_V = mkV163 "ďëţ˙" ;
|
||||
-- stand_V = IrregEng.stand_V ;
|
||||
-- swell_V = IrregEng.swell_V ;
|
||||
swim_V = mkV186 "ďëóâŕě" ;
|
||||
think_V = mkV173 "ěčńë˙" ;
|
||||
turn_V = mkV186 "îáđúůŕě" ;
|
||||
-- vomit_V = regV "vomit" ;
|
||||
|
||||
-- bite_V2 = dirV2 IrregEng.bite_V ;
|
||||
count_V2 = dirV2 (mkV175 "áđî˙") ;
|
||||
cut_V2 = dirV2 (mkV157 "đĺćŕ") ;
|
||||
fear_V2 = dirV2 (mkV186 "ńňđŕőóâŕě") ;
|
||||
fight_V2 = dirV2 (mkV173 "áîđ˙") ;
|
||||
-- hit_V2 = dirV2 hit_V ;
|
||||
-- hold_V2 = dirV2 hold_V ;
|
||||
hunt_V2 = dirV2 (mkV174 "ëîâ˙") ;
|
||||
kill_V2 = dirV2 (mkV163 "óáč˙") ;
|
||||
-- pull_V2 = dirV2 (regV "pull") ;
|
||||
-- push_V2 = dirV2 (regV "push") ;
|
||||
-- rub_V2 = dirV2 (regDuplV "rub") ;
|
||||
-- scratch_V2 = dirV2 (regV "scratch") ;
|
||||
split_V2 = dirV2 (mkV174 "đŕçäĺë˙") ;
|
||||
-- squeeze_V2 = dirV2 (regV "squeeze") ;
|
||||
-- stab_V2 = dirV2 (regDuplV "stab") ;
|
||||
-- suck_V2 = dirV2 (regV "suck") ;
|
||||
throw_V2 = dirV2 (mkV173 "őâúđë˙") ;
|
||||
-- tie_V2 = dirV2 (regV "tie") ;
|
||||
wash_V2 = dirV2 (mkV163 "ěč˙") ;
|
||||
-- wipe_V2 = dirV2 (regV "wipe") ;
|
||||
|
||||
ready_A = mkA76 "ăîňîâ" ;
|
||||
today_Adv = mkAdv "äíĺń" ;
|
||||
uncertain_A = mkA79 "íĺ˙ńĺí" ;
|
||||
|
||||
oper
|
||||
zaP = mkPrep "çŕ" ;
|
||||
naP = mkPrep "íŕ" ;
|
||||
doP = mkPrep "äî" ;
|
||||
} ;
|
||||
Reference in New Issue
Block a user